The Tiny Kitten With a Tremendous Will to Live Akindi's story began with a faint, desperate meow. A friend of one of our volunteers kept hearing the sound, soft but persistent, and was determined to find the source. What they eventually discovered was a tiny, fragile kitten — alone, distressed, and fighting for his life. When he was brought to us, we assumed he must only be a few weeks old because of his size. But after a quick examination from our onsite veterinary team, we learned the truth: Akindi was actually around nine weeks old, but severely malnourished, weak, and suffering from a painfully swollen stomach filled with parasites. His condition was so delicate that we weren’t sure if he would survive. He was so little that he moved into Emma’s bedroom where he could receive constant care, warmth, and reassurance. It was there that he formed an instant bond with Iggy, Emma & Edo's son. Iggy’s gentle nature and patient affection showed Akindi a kind of love and safety he had never felt before and it gave him the strength he needed to keep fighting. Fast forward three months, and Akindi has transformed. He is now a strong, social, spirited young cat — still the smallest of his little group, but full of life and confidence. He plays endlessly with Iggy and their two other kitties, proving every day just how far a bit of love, safety, and determined care can go. Akindi may have started as the tiniest and most fragile kitten we’ve seen, but today he is a joyful reminder of resilience and second chances.
